As a SUPER pale girl with a very pink undertone, I've used the hard candy foundation for YEARS. It's one of TWO drugstore foundations that actually has my pasty shade and doesn't make me look orange or yellow....but I keep using it instead of the other (loreal infallible powder foundation) because of how pretty it looks on the skin and how long lasting it is. Cosmetic companies (rightly so) have spent so much time extending the shades on the deep end of the spectrum, but they haven't extended the light end at all. Especially with drugstore. They tend to think everyone is beige and tan....and have terrible unrealistic options for anyone who is lighter or darker than that. The main problem people like me have is even the lightest shade (porcelain or ivory) has an ORANGE undertone....making it look like we've had a bad spray tan only on the face. Hard Candy has a shade though....that's even too pale for ME (it's basically just white, lol). It's why they will always have my heart when it comes to makeup....plus I've always thought their packaging is cute❤

Dineh Mohajer, the brand's founder sold the brand to LVMH in the late ,90's, so it's not surprising it was in Sephora as both are LVMH properties. The brand lost its star power so LVMH sold it to another company who owns it currently
